| Creator: Mark Tilden Found at: Solarbotics Bot name: Magbot Description: Mark Tilden's Butterfly -a-proof-of-concept that the Solarengine can be used to drive inductive loads other than motors. The implications are that otherdevices suitably propelled may be able to use solar power to navigate and propel themselves against earth's magnetic field. |

| Creator: Dave Web Site: Solarbotics Bot name: Solar Fly Description: My own Solar Fly - a window ornament that flaps wings every 10 minutes. An involved experience learning the finer points of construction. One thing to always remember - don't use MIG wire in high-stress locations - the copper cladding will rip off. |

| Creator: Richard Piotter Web Site: Richfiles Bot Name: Floor Monkey Description: The Floor Monkey is a Bicore driven robot. The Bicore is a 2 Nv loop. It uses the 74AC240, a driving, schmitt inverter chip. It uses a pair of photo diodes to bias the amount of turn per direction. The rear is a leg like device attached to a Maxon motor. The motor does not have enough drive for legs, so I salvaged them from MECI IV M and used it for this and for a future 4 segemnt, 3 motor snake. This robot is similar to a "head" which is a inary light seeking device that aims itself in the direction of the brightest light source. The diference here, is it simply sits on a floor or table and tumbles it's tail so the front faces the brightest light source. The obvious diference is that there is no stand. It simply sits on the floor. |
